Grid analysis Claude AI
At 06:00 on 7 July, wind generation dominates the German grid at 29.6 GW combined (onshore 24.0 GW, offshore 5.6 GW), delivering the bulk of a 75.8% renewable share. Brown coal provides a substantial 7.2 GW baseload contribution, with biomass at 3.9 GW and natural gas at 3.4 GW filling the conventional remainder. Total domestic generation of 49.8 GW falls 3.3 GW short of 53.1 GW consumption, requiring net imports of approximately 3.3 GW. The day-ahead price of 115.6 EUR/MWh is elevated for a summer morning with this renewable share, likely reflecting tight interconnector capacity and the residual thermal dispatch needed under heavy overcast conditions that are suppressing early-morning solar output to just 2.9 GW.
